Method

Preparation

  1. 1

    Prepare the Seafood

    Clean and prepare all the seafood: peel the shrimp, clean the clams and mussels, and cut the monkfish and sepia into bite-sized pieces.

  2. 2

    Soak the Saffron

    In a small bowl, soak the saffron threads in a couple of tablespoons of warm water to release their flavor.

Cooking

  1. 3

    Sauté Aromatics

    In a large paella pan or wide sk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, and sauté until the onion is translucent.

  2. 4

    Add Seafood

    Add the monkfish, sepia, squid, and shrimp to the pan. Cook for about 5-7 minutes until the seafood starts to turn opaque.

  3. 5

    Add Rice

    Stir in the bomba rice and cook for another 2-3 minutes, allowing the rice to absorb the flavors.

  4. 6

    Add Liquid

    Pour in the water or seafood stock, and add the soaked saffron along with its soaking water. Season with salt and black pepper to taste. Stir to combine.

  5. 7

    Simmer

    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low. Let it simmer for about 10 minutes without stirring.

  6. 8

    Add Clams and Mussels

    After 10 minutes, add the cleaned clams and mussels on top of the rice. Cover the pan with a lid or foil and cook for another 5-10 minutes until the clams and mussels have opened and the rice is tender.

  7. 9

    Final Touch

    Once cooked, remove the paella from the heat and let it rest for 5 minutes. Drizzle with salsa verde before serving.
